Satellite Navigation near me in Ilford, Essex

Close filters
View map

If you don't know whether you're coming or going, it might be time to invest in a sat nav. Step in the right direction, by purchasing a domestic or commercial system from these top-rated Satellite Navigation suppliers in Ilford, Essex on

Business not here?

Is the business you’re looking for not listed? Tell us what we’re missing.

Add a business